Instructions

# Perplexity CI Integration ## Overview Set up CI/CD pipelines for Perplexity integrations with automated testing. ## Prerequisites - GitHub repository with Actions enabled - Perplexity test API key - npm/pnpm project configured ## Instructions ### Step 1: Create GitHub Actions Workflow Create `.github/workflows/perplexity-integration.yml`: ```yaml name: Perplexity Integration Tests on: push: branches: [main] pull_request: branches: [main] env: PERPLEXITY_API_KEY: ${{ secrets.PERPLEXITY_API_KEY }} jobs: test: runs-on: ubuntu-latest env: PERPLEXITY_API_KEY: ${{ secrets.PERPLEXITY_API_KEY }} steps: - uses: actions/checkout@v4 - uses: actions/setup-node@v4 with: node-version: '20' cache: 'npm' - run: npm ci - run: npm test -- --coverage - run: npm run test:integration ``` ### Step 2: Configure Secrets ```bash gh secret set PERPLEXITY_API_KEY --body "sk_test_***" ``` ### Step 3: Add Integration Tests ```typescript describe('Perplexity Integration', () => { it.skipIf(!process.env.PERPLEXITY_API_KEY)('should connect', async () => { const client = getPerplexityClient(); const result = await client.healthCheck(); expect(result.status).toBe('ok'); }); }); ``` ## Output - Automated test pipeline - PR checks configured - Coverage reports uploaded - Release workflow ready ## Error Handling | Issue | Cause | Solution | |-------|-------|----------| | Secret not found | Missing configuration | Add secret via `gh secret set` | | Tests timeout | Network issues | Increase timeout or mock | | Auth failures | Invalid key | Check secret value | ## Examples ### Release Workflow ```yaml on: push: tags: ['v*'] jobs: release: runs-on: ubuntu-latest env: PERPLEXITY_API_KEY: ${{ secrets.PERPLEXITY_API_KEY_PROD }} steps: - uses: actions/checkout@v4 - uses: actions/setup-node@v4 with: node-version: '20' - run: npm ci - name: Verify Perplexity production readiness run: npm run test:integration - run: npm run build - run: npm publish ``` ### Branch Protection ```yaml required_status_checks: - "test" - "perplexity-integration" ``` ## Resources - [GitHub Actions Documentation](https://docs.github.com/en/actions) - [Perplexity CI Guide](https://docs.perplexity.com/ci) ## Next Steps For deployment patterns, see `perplexity-deploy-integration`.
